## Relevance Tuning for Quillfinder Plugins

If your plugin contributes documents to the Quillfinder index, be aware that field boosts and freshness decay are applied after your custom scoring function runs. Do not attempt to compensate for decay inside your plugin — it causes oscillating rankings. Test against the staging corpus first. The tuning notes and boost tables are maintained on the internal page below.

runbook for badug-kadup: https://confluence.zemvarlabs.internal/projects/browse/display/projects/bd1b

## Sensor drift: what to do at 3am

If the GrowLoop controller starts reporting humidity swings that don't match the backup probes in the Fernwick greenhouse, it's almost always sensor drift, not an actual climate event. Don't panic and don't touch the vents manually. First, restart the calibration daemon and give it ten minutes to re-baseline. If readings still disagree by more than 5%, flip the controller into safe mode. The safe-mode thresholds it will use are these.

config for yahap-bajof:
[istix]
host = istix.qorvelsys.internal
user = istix_svc
database = istix_prod

## Authentication

Hey support crew — the ContrastCheck audit tool needs to auth against our internal Palettegate service before it can scan any pages. Without auth you'll just get empty reports, which confuses everyone. Each support seat shares one key for now (proper per-user tokens are coming, promise). Paste in the key shown just below this line.

app token of fahip-badug = kto15_1KZslTEs4APfT3d

2024-11-08 — Key rotation. After the humidity sensors in the Fernwell greenhouse controller started drifting again (thanks, condensation), we recalibrated and rotated the firmware signing credentials while we were in there. Future maintainers: drift recalibration and key rotation now happen together, on purpose. Flash builds must be signed with the following key.

release key, fahaf-bajof: bky3_Xam